Heaters Electric – Why They’re Eco-Friendly and Efficient

Electric heaters are a great way to warm up a room quickly. They use convection to distribute heat evenly across an area and can be combined with a thermostat to conserve energy. They are also small and quiet.

Some models include an air circulator to help cool the room during hotter temperatures. They can also be used with a smart plug, which lets you program your heater to turn off and on at specific times.

The effectiveness of electric heaters is measured by their capacity to convert electrical energy into useful heat energy without losing any of it. The energy efficiency rating is displayed as grades or stars. Energy efficiency ratings that are higher indicate less electricity is required and a lower price over time.

Certain factors can affect the efficiency of electric heaters, such as insulation and thermostat control. Insufficient insulation lets heat escape and cause the heaters to work harder. This increases the energy consumption and cost. Poor quality thermostats can also cause temperature fluctuations and force the heater to work harder to maintain a precise temperature setting.

Electric heaters can be a convenient and cost-effective way to heat a space without the need to install central heating units. They work on the same principle as plumbed radiators however they do not rely on a boiler or a network of pipes to distribute the heat. They make use of the heating element, typically nichrome wire that converts electricity into heat.
